.page-head[data-astro-cid-swvyjs47]{padding-top:.5rem}.page-title[data-astro-cid-swvyjs47]{font-family:var(--font-display);font-size:clamp(1.75rem,4vw,2.35rem);margin:.5rem 0 .35rem;color:var(--color-primary)}.section--tight{padding-top:1.5rem}.overview-section[data-astro-cid-swvyjs47]{padding-bottom:clamp(1.5rem,4vw,2.75rem)}.overview[data-astro-cid-swvyjs47]{display:grid;gap:1.2rem;align-items:start}@media(min-width:940px){.overview[data-astro-cid-swvyjs47]{grid-template-columns:minmax(0,380px) minmax(0,1fr);gap:1.6rem;align-items:stretch}}.overview__text[data-astro-cid-swvyjs47]{display:flex;flex-direction:column;gap:1.35rem}@media(min-width:940px){.overview__text[data-astro-cid-swvyjs47]{display:flex;flex-direction:column;min-height:0;height:100%;align-self:stretch}.overview__text[data-astro-cid-swvyjs47] .facts[data-astro-cid-swvyjs47]{flex:1 1 auto;min-height:0}.overview__text[data-astro-cid-swvyjs47] .actions[data-astro-cid-swvyjs47]{flex-shrink:0;margin-top:auto}}.overview__text[data-astro-cid-swvyjs47] .actions[data-astro-cid-swvyjs47]{margin-bottom:.35rem;padding:1rem 0 1.1rem;width:100%;box-sizing:border-box}@media(max-width:939px){.overview__text[data-astro-cid-swvyjs47] .actions[data-astro-cid-swvyjs47]{margin-top:.35rem}}.overview__img[data-astro-cid-swvyjs47]{width:100%;border-radius:var(--radius-lg);border:1px solid var(--color-border);box-shadow:var(--shadow-md);display:block}.facts[data-astro-cid-swvyjs47]{margin:0;padding:0;list-style:none;color:var(--color-muted);display:grid;gap:.7rem}.facts[data-astro-cid-swvyjs47] li[data-astro-cid-swvyjs47]{border:1px solid var(--color-border);border-radius:var(--radius-sm);background:var(--color-surface);padding:.65rem .75rem;display:flex;flex-direction:column;gap:.25rem;box-shadow:var(--shadow-sm)}.facts[data-astro-cid-swvyjs47] li[data-astro-cid-swvyjs47] strong[data-astro-cid-swvyjs47]{color:var(--color-primary);font-size:.92rem;line-height:1.2}.facts[data-astro-cid-swvyjs47] li[data-astro-cid-swvyjs47]>span[data-astro-cid-swvyjs47]:not(.fact-icon){line-height:1.35;font-size:.93rem}.fact-icon[data-astro-cid-swvyjs47]{display:inline-block;width:3rem;height:3rem;flex-shrink:0;background-repeat:no-repeat;background-position:center;background-size:contain;margin-bottom:.15rem}@media(min-width:940px){.facts[data-astro-cid-swvyjs47]{grid-template-columns:repeat(2,minmax(0,1fr));margin:0;align-content:start}}.fact-icon--date[data-astro-cid-swvyjs47]{background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 24 24' fill='none' stroke='%23153a66' stroke-width='1.8' stroke-linecap='round' stroke-linejoin='round'%3E%3Crect x='3' y='4.5' width='18' height='16' rx='2.5'/%3E%3Cpath d='M8 3v3M16 3v3M3 9h18'/%3E%3C/svg%3E")}.fact-icon--venue[data-astro-cid-swvyjs47]{background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 24 24' fill='none' stroke='%23153a66' stroke-width='1.8' stroke-linecap='round' stroke-linejoin='round'%3E%3Cpath d='M3.5 20.5h17'/%3E%3Cpath d='M6 20.5V7l6-3 6 3v13.5'/%3E%3Cpath d='M9 10h1M14 10h1M9 13.5h1M14 13.5h1M11.5 20.5V16h1v4.5'/%3E%3C/svg%3E")}.fact-icon--address[data-astro-cid-swvyjs47]{background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 24 24' fill='none' stroke='%23153a66' stroke-width='1.8' stroke-linecap='round' stroke-linejoin='round'%3E%3Cpath d='M12 21s-6-5.55-6-10a6 6 0 1 1 12 0c0 4.45-6 10-6 10Z'/%3E%3Ccircle cx='12' cy='11' r='2.5'/%3E%3C/svg%3E")}.fact-icon--organizer[data-astro-cid-swvyjs47]{background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 24 24' fill='none' stroke='%23153a66' stroke-width='1.8' stroke-linecap='round' stroke-linejoin='round'%3E%3Cpath d='M4 20.5h16'/%3E%3Crect x='4' y='8' width='16' height='12' rx='2'/%3E%3Cpath d='M8 8V5.5h8V8M8 12h8'/%3E%3C/svg%3E")}.fact-icon--support[data-astro-cid-swvyjs47]{background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 24 24' fill='none' stroke='%23153a66' stroke-width='1.8' stroke-linecap='round' stroke-linejoin='round'%3E%3Cpath d='M7 12a3.5 3.5 0 1 1 0-7h2.5M17 12a3.5 3.5 0 1 0 0-7h-2.5M8.5 8.5h7M8.5 12h7M8.5 15.5h7'/%3E%3C/svg%3E")}.fact-icon--free[data-astro-cid-swvyjs47]{background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 24 24' fill='none' stroke='%23153a66' stroke-width='1.8' stroke-linecap='round' stroke-linejoin='round'%3E%3Cpath d='M12 21s-6-3.4-8-6.6V6.7l8-3 8 3v7.7C18 17.6 12 21 12 21Z'/%3E%3Cpath d='m9 12 2 2 4-4'/%3E%3C/svg%3E")}.actions[data-astro-cid-swvyjs47]{display:flex;flex-wrap:wrap;gap:.65rem}.fit-check[data-astro-cid-swvyjs47]{border:1px solid var(--color-border);border-radius:var(--radius-md);background:linear-gradient(180deg,#fff,#f7fbff);box-shadow:0 10px 24px #03254f17;padding:clamp(1rem,2vw,1.35rem);display:grid;gap:.95rem}.fit-check--split[data-astro-cid-swvyjs47]{grid-template-columns:1fr}.fit-check__main[data-astro-cid-swvyjs47]{display:grid;gap:.8rem}.fit-check__aside[data-astro-cid-swvyjs47]{border-top:1px dashed #c5dcf5;padding-top:.85rem;display:grid;gap:.7rem}@media(min-width:980px){.fit-check--split[data-astro-cid-swvyjs47]{grid-template-columns:minmax(0,1.5fr) minmax(0,1fr);align-items:start;gap:1rem}.fit-check__aside[data-astro-cid-swvyjs47]{border-top:0;border-left:1px dashed #c5dcf5;padding-top:0;padding-left:1rem;min-height:100%;align-content:start}}.fit-check__lead[data-astro-cid-swvyjs47]{margin:0;color:#1f3652;font-weight:700;line-height:1.5}.fit-check__list[data-astro-cid-swvyjs47]{margin:0;padding-left:0;list-style:none;display:grid;gap:.52rem;color:#1f3652}.fit-check__list[data-astro-cid-swvyjs47] li[data-astro-cid-swvyjs47]{position:relative;padding:.56rem .62rem .56rem 1.95rem;border:1px solid #d9e8f8;border-radius:10px;background:#fff;font-size:.96rem;line-height:1.45}.fit-check__list[data-astro-cid-swvyjs47] li[data-astro-cid-swvyjs47]:before{content:"";position:absolute;top:.92rem;left:.74rem;width:.6rem;height:.6rem;border-radius:999px;background:linear-gradient(180deg,#2d8de4,#0e5ea8);box-shadow:0 0 0 3px #eaf4ff}.fit-check__hint[data-astro-cid-swvyjs47]{margin:0;color:#294564;line-height:1.45;font-size:.93rem}.next[data-astro-cid-swvyjs47] .actions[data-astro-cid-swvyjs47]{margin-top:.35rem;padding-top:.35rem}.cards[data-astro-cid-swvyjs47]{display:grid;gap:1rem}@media(min-width:860px){.cards[data-astro-cid-swvyjs47]{grid-template-columns:repeat(3,1fr)}}.card[data-astro-cid-swvyjs47]{margin:0;padding:1.1rem 1.2rem;border-radius:var(--radius-md);border:1px solid var(--color-border);background:var(--color-surface);box-shadow:var(--shadow-sm)}.card[data-astro-cid-swvyjs47] h2[data-astro-cid-swvyjs47]{margin:0 0 .45rem;font-family:var(--font-display);color:var(--color-primary);font-size:1.05rem}.card[data-astro-cid-swvyjs47] p[data-astro-cid-swvyjs47]{margin:0;color:var(--color-muted)}.audience[data-astro-cid-swvyjs47]{margin:0;padding:0;list-style:none;display:grid;gap:.9rem;max-width:100%}.audience[data-astro-cid-swvyjs47] li[data-astro-cid-swvyjs47]{margin:0;padding:.95rem 1rem;border:1px solid var(--color-border);border-radius:var(--radius-md);background:#fff;box-shadow:var(--shadow-sm)}.audience[data-astro-cid-swvyjs47] li[data-astro-cid-swvyjs47] h3[data-astro-cid-swvyjs47]{margin:0 0 .35rem;font-family:var(--font-display);color:#052f63;font-size:clamp(1.18rem,2vw,1.42rem);line-height:1.2;font-weight:800;letter-spacing:.01em;text-wrap:balance}.audience[data-astro-cid-swvyjs47] li[data-astro-cid-swvyjs47] p[data-astro-cid-swvyjs47]{margin:0;color:var(--color-muted);line-height:1.5;font-size:.95rem}@media(min-width:900px){.audience[data-astro-cid-swvyjs47]{grid-template-columns:repeat(2,minmax(0,1fr))}}.next[data-astro-cid-swvyjs47]{max-width:52rem}.next[data-astro-cid-swvyjs47] p[data-astro-cid-swvyjs47]{margin:0 0 1rem;color:var(--color-muted)}
